WebThey live around the border between Brazil and Venezuela occupying the largest area of tropical rainforest by an indigenous group anywhere in the world. The Yanomami day is mostly filled with leisure and social activities as they generally satisfy their needs after around 4 hours of work. They live off small scale agriculture, fishing and hunting. WebAug 3, 2024 · The Xikrin Indigenous People of Bacajá, numbering 1,067 people, live in 15 villages in the Trincheira Bacajá Indigenous Land, a territory spanning 1.65 million hectares in Brazil's Pará state in the heart of the Amazon Rainforest.
